Sec. 8883.054. COMPENSATION; EXPENSES.

(a)Unless the board by resolution increases the fees of office to an amount authorized by Section 36.060 (a), Water Code, each director is entitled to receive for the director's services $25 a month in compensation.
(b)Each director may be reimbursed for actual expenses incurred in the performance of official duties.
(c)The expenses described by Subsection (b) must be:
(1)reported in the district's records; and
(2)approved by the board. SUBCHAPTER C. POWERS AND DUTIES
